Julphar’s supply chain is geared to efficiently
supply the company’s diverse products across
markets. Separate warehouses are available for
different product categories – finished
products, raw materials, packaging materials,
bottles, etc. All the warehouses are
temperature- and humidity-controlled, and fully
GMP-compliant.

During the year, a new state-of-the-art
blistering machine was added in Julphar-IV to
increase the capacity of Julmentin tablets.
There were additions in Julphar-VI too. The
filling area was equipped with a new capping
machine to run with both plastic PP caps and
aluminum PP caps. The new equipment was sourced
from Bausch-Stroebel, Germany.
Order has also been placed for new powder
filling lines to increase our PPS capacity.
The ointments, cream & suppositories plant –
Julphar-X – has started running in full swing
from December 2011.
As part of new plans to meet the projected
demand for the next five years, orders have been
placed for a new blistering machine with
Ulhmann, Germany, and two full lines with CAM,
Italy. New technical manpower is also being
recruited to meet future staffing needs.
